Odometer and Speedometer died

My odometer and speedometer died on my 84 vw rabbit, however my fuel guage and clock still work on my dash. Is there any way to fix this...maybe a switch or something needs to be replaced? Also my horn just started to honk by itself. Any suggestions?

Re: Odometer and Speedometer died

Ive had the button fail, also could be a defective horn ring. The speedo/odo stops because a little plastic drive gear inside slips on it's metal shaft. Repair kits are available, but it's a tedious job.

Re: Odometer and Speedometer died

The slipping gear is more common on the A2's. In addition to the cable there is a black box on the firewall that the cable runs through that sets the oxygen sensor light. The internal gears on the box can fail.
